20120140959 | SOUND SYSTEM AND METHOD OF SOUND REPRODUCTION - A sound reproduction system comprises a left and right speakers located in close proximity, and a sound processor which provides audio signals to the pair of speakers. The sound processor preferably derives a cancellation signal from the difference between the left and right channels. The resulting difference signal is scaled, delayed (if necessary), and spectrally modified before being added to the left channel and, in opposite polarity, to the right channel. The spectral modification to the difference channel preferably takes the form of a low-frequency boost over a specified frequency range, in order to restore the correct timbral balance after the differencing process. Additional phase-compensating all-pass networks may be inserted in the difference channel to correct for any extra phase shift contributed by the spectral modifying circuit. The technique may be used in a surround sound system. | 2012-06-07 |

20120140988 | OBSTACLE DETECTION DEVICE AND METHOD AND OBSTACLE DETECTION SYSTEM - An obstacle region candidate point relating unit assumes that a pixel in an image corresponds to a point on a road surface, and associates pixels between images at two times on the basis of the amount of movement of a vehicle in question, a road plane, and a flow of the image estimated. When a pixel corresponds to a shadow of the vehicle in question or the moving object therearound appearing on the road surface, the ratio of intensities of the pixel values of the spectral images between two images should be approximately the same as the ratio of the spectral characteristics of the sunshine in the sun and the shade. Therefore, when the ratio of intensities is approximately the same as the ratio of the spectral characteristics, the obstacle determining unit does not determine that the pixel in question is a point corresponding to the obstacle. Only when the ratio of intensities is not approximately the same as the ratio of the spectral characteristics, the obstacle determining unit determines that the pixel in question is a point corresponding to the obstacle. | 2012-06-07 |

20120140997 | Tools for automatic colonic centerline extraction - A method for extracting a colonic centerline includes segmenting a colon from a digital image of a patient's abdomen, selecting one extreme point of the colon as a source point, calculating a first distance transform of every point in the colon that is a distance of a point to the source point, and calculating a second distance transform of every point in the colon, that is a shortest distance of a point to a wall point of the colon. A centerline path is generated through the colon using the first and second distance transforms, starting from a point with a greatest distance to the source point as determined by the first distance transform, and adding points to the centerline path by selecting points with a greatest distance to the source point that are farthest from the wall of the colon using the second distance transform. | 2012-06-07 |
